Syllabus for Comprehensive Japanese Course, First Semester 2019 (Asakura Campus)

I. Outline

The course is for any international student registered at Asakura campus of Kochi University. Students are required to take a placement test before the course starts in the second week of April. Basic Japanese is for students who have never learnet Japanese. Elementary-Intermediate Japanese Conversation I, Elementary-Intermediate Japanese Structure, Intermediate Composition, Intermediate Kanji and Vocabulary, Intermediate Conversation I, Intermediate Listening Comprehension I and Kochi Culture and Sociiety are for intermediate class students who have learnt Japanese. Communication Japanese I is for students in upper intermediate class, and Business Japanese and Academic Writing are for students with advanced skills.

 

Ⅱ. Course Levels

An introductory level course is for students who learn Japanese for the first time. It is expected that students will learn essential knowledge for studying Japanese and essential skills for communication in daily life. Students at an introductory level course should be able to pass the level N5 of the Japanese-Language Proficiency Test. An intermediate-level course is for students who have completed the elementary course.  Students at an intermediate-level course should be able to pass the level N2 of the Japanese-Language Proficiency Test. Students at an upper-intermediate class are required to pass the N2 of the Japanese-Language Proficiency, and an advanced course is for students who have passed or are likely to pass the level N1 of the Japanese-Language Proficiency Test.
